What Really Is Emergency Chiropractic Care?

Emergency chiropractic describes prompt, priority chiropractic evaluation and treatment for unexpected musculoskeletal conditions. Unlike routine chiropractic sessions that focus on chronic or long-term pain patterns, emergency chiropractic zeroes in on addressing the body after a traumatic event in order to prevent inflammation, soft tissue damage compound. Time is a real factor — the sooner a licensed chiropractor assesses a fresh trauma, the better the prognosis.

From a structural standpoint, emergency chiropractic works by restoring correct orientation to the vertebrae and surrounding tissues. When a sudden force disrupts the musculoskeletal system, joints can lock out of normal position, compressing the surrounding tissues that extend from the spinal cord. A experienced chiropractor delivers controlled manual adjustments to return joint mobility and decrease nerve irritation.

The methods used in emergency chiropractic may include high-velocity low-amplitude adjustments, trigger point work, flexion-distraction, and corrective exercises. The Emergency Chiropractic Process In Detail

  1. Emergency Arrival and Check-In — When you arrive at our facility, our administrative team expedites your paperwork to cut down on wait time. You'll concisely describe the nature of your accident, when symptoms began, and your current areas of concern. Efficiency at this step guarantees the doctor has the information needed to start the evaluation immediately.
  2. Acute Assessment — A licensed chiropractor performs a thorough physical and neurological examination. This includes palpating the vertebral column, assessing joint mobility, and pinpointing regions with tenderness. When warranted, on-site imaging can be performed the same day to identify structural damage before hands-on therapy is initiated.
  3. Assessment Results and Planning — Drawing from the examination findings, your provider identifies the precise injuries contributing to your symptoms and reviews a straightforward clinical strategy. The diagnosis phase confirms you are aware of what structures need attention and what the intervention is intended to accomplish.
  4. Manual Therapy — The heart of emergency chiropractic treatment is the manual corrective technique. Using calculated pressure, the chiropractor returns restricted vertebral levels to their correct alignment. According to your injury profile, this may include neck manipulation, mid-back therapy, sacral and lumbar correction, or all three thereof.
  5. Muscle and Fascia Treatment — Following the joint correction, your provider may deliver muscle-focused therapies such as therapeutic massage, electrical muscle stimulation, or ice and compression to minimize residual muscle tension and enhance the healing process.
  6. Home Care Instructions — Before you leave, your provider gives clear home care protocols. These commonly include anti-inflammatory positioning, movement modifications, postural recommendations, and gentle stretches designed to maintain the progress made during your urgent session.
  7. Continuity of Care — Emergency chiropractic typically benefits from a structured sequence of subsequent sessions to completely address the initial episode. Your provider sets up additional appointments before you depart, ensuring a clear plan is established from the very start.

Emergency Chiropractic Frequently Asked Questions

What is the typical duration of an emergency chiropractic session last?

A same-day emergency chiropractic visit generally lasts between 45 and 90 minutes, depending on the scope of your condition. This encompasses intake paperwork, the comprehensive examination, same-day imaging, and the primary adjustment itself. Follow-up emergency chiropractic visits often take shorter as your provider already has your history.

Is emergency chiropractic painful?

The majority of people find that emergency chiropractic care cause minimal discomfort during the session itself. Some people notice mild next-day soreness — much like how you feel after a intense exercise session. This usually resolves within 24 to 48 hours. Our providers use measured force tailored to your individual injury severity.

How soon will I experience results from emergency chiropractic care?

Many people notice significant improvement directly after their first emergency chiropractic appointment. Complete resolution depends on the type of the injury, your physical baseline, and how consistently you follow your prescribed care plan. Acute injuries managed without delay through emergency chiropractic typically heal in less time than cases which have been left untreated.
